FUJIFILM GF 110mm f/2 R LM WR
Why this lens
- Often referred to as the 'king of GFX portrait lenses,' its 87mm full-frame equivalent focal length is ideal for classic portraiture, offering a natural perspective and comfortable working distance.
- The fast f/2 aperture provides incredibly shallow depth of field and beautiful, creamy bokeh, allowing for excellent subject separation.
- Equipped with a linear motor for fast, quiet, and precise autofocus, crucial for capturing fleeting expressions.

FUJIFILM GF 80mm f/1.7 R WR
Why this lens
- This is the fastest aperture lens available for the GFX system, offering an even shallower depth of field than the 110mm f/2, with a 63mm full-frame equivalent focal length.
- Its incredibly wide f/1.7 aperture excels in low-light conditions and creates an ethereal background blur, perfect for artistic portraits.
- Provides a versatile field of view suitable for both intimate headshots and broader environmental portraits.
FUJIFILM GF 55mm f/1.7 R WR
Why this lens
- Offers a natural viewing angle, equivalent to approximately 44mm on a full-frame camera, making it highly versatile for various portrait styles, including full-body and environmental portraits.
- The f/1.7 aperture provides excellent light-gathering capabilities and produces sumptuously smooth and dreamy bokeh, ideal for subject isolation.
- Delivers stunning image quality with spectacular sharpness across the entire frame.
FUJIFILM GF 120mm f/4 R LM OIS WR Macro
Why this lens
- While primarily a macro lens, its 95mm full-frame equivalent focal length is excellent for detailed portraiture, especially headshots and beauty shots.
- The f/4 aperture, combined with the medium format sensor, still provides good subject separation and pleasing bokeh.
- Features Optical Image Stabilization (OIS), which is beneficial for handheld shooting, especially in challenging light or when precise framing is needed.
FUJIFILM GF 63mm f/2.8 R WR
Why this lens
- This lens provides a 'nifty fifty' equivalent focal length (50mm full-frame equivalent), making it a versatile standard prime for environmental portraits and general use.
- It is one of the most compact and lightweight GF lenses, making it an excellent choice for photographers who prioritize portability without sacrificing image quality.
- The f/2.8 aperture, while not as wide as other options, still offers good depth of field control and excellent sharpness.

Leveraging 102MP Detail
- For studio portraits, use a sturdy tripod to eliminate any micro-vibrations, ensuring every pixel is tack sharp.
- Pay meticulous attention to skin texture and hair details, as the sensor will resolve them with stunning clarity.
- Consider tethered shooting to review images instantly on a larger screen, confirming critical focus and composition.
